I would perform a hard reset. Performing a hard reset will remove ALL data including the Google account, system data, application data, application settings, and downloaded applications. To perform a hard reset follow the directions below:
From the home screen click the applications tab
Touch settings
Touch privacy
Touch Factory Data reset
Touch reset phone (If presented, enter the current passcode or draw the unlock pattern.)
Touch erase everything

    Let the tech people at your Apple store check out the computer. Some vibration from hard drives is quite normal, and some manufacturers' drives vibrate more than others. However, it's possible that the drive in your computer is missing a dampener in the drive mounting. It's also possible that the vibration is normal.
    If you have someone actually check it out along side another MacBook perhaps it will help you determine if you really have a problem.
    The hard drives in MacBooks are DIY replacement items. It's fairly easy to check if the drive has been properly installed.
    It's also possible it's not the drive at all, but the fans.
